Output 134e6c30f521ea29dbd735453012a5d626ada2aa907627fe828c2fda7ee040c2:0

value
48581029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aa385011cf458f9940958a6aa42d2e24ee45fc7 OP_EQUAL
address
M8sQstLNPXwwtTMb2xMAkS3ghVgns6h5iT
transaction
134e6c30f521ea29dbd735453012a5d626ada2aa907627fe828c2fda7ee040c2
spent
true